You only need three ingredients to get you started. Some bacon, some Pillsbury Grands flaky buns, and some mozzarella cheese. To start cut up the mozzarella cheese into one-inch squares. Then cut the individual biscuits in half, and crap each biscuit half around the mozzarella cheese. Then take a slice of bacon and wrap it around the biscuit, making sure to wrap the whole biscuit with bacon. Take a thick toothpick and poke it through to secure.

In a cast iron frying pan, you can heat up some canola oil until it reaches 350 degrees Fahrenheit. Fry about two or three of them at a time. Make sure to give them a flip, so that they fry evenly on both sides. When the cheese recipe is complete take them out, and let them sit on a paper towel to cool and drain.
